WebDictionary entry details • POLYGYNOUS (adjective) Sense 1. Meaning: Having more than one wife at a time. Similar: polygamous (having more than one mate at a time; used of … WebOct 27, 2024 · Polygamy a word from ancient Greek means a state of being in the marriage to more than one spouse. There is further segmentation in these terms. When a man is in a bind of marriage with more than one woman, it is called polygyny. Meanwhile, on the other hand, when a woman is married to more than one man at a time, it is known as polyandry.

WebPolygynous birds of paradise. As mentioned above, many species of birds of paradise are sexually dimorphic, meaning the males and females have different appearances. The males have elaborate plumage patterns, which are used in their mating displays. The females of these species are drab and cryptic.

WebSep 10, 2024 · Pharaoh ants are polygynous, meaning that a single colony will have multiple reproductive queens. This has important implications for the control of this species. Reproduction. Pharaoh ants colonies are large, containing thousands or even hundreds of thousands of workers.

WebSea otters are polygynous, meaning that males have multiple female partners. Males are usually territorial, typically mating with several females in an area that they defend.
